Thanks, Graham, that works...!Moreover, I found that the voices must be 1-2 or 3-4, mixing \voiceTwo with \voiceThree will not work. The trick is to call \voiceTwo or \voiceThree on the middle voice when switching to upper or lover staff respectively.
This is the default behaviour of multiple voices on one staff. Why are you entering \stemBoth? Do you need it for some reason? (I can't think of any) If you comment out your \stemBoth, you should get the desired behavor. Cheers, - Graham
